London City Lionesses appoint Lizzie Fluke as Head of Performance


The London City Lionesses are proud to announce the appointment of Lizzie Fluke as the club’s new Head of Performance.


Fluke has joined the Lionesses off the back of working with Malmö FF with the men’s first team, as well as Scotland Women’s youth national squads, and Hibernian FC.


In her career so far, she’s worked in the Allsvenskan and Damallsvenskan, the highest levels of professional football in Sweden, this also includes Europa League competition experience, and preparing teams for the Champions League.


In her role at London City, she’ll be responsible for the performance department, with the goal of improving player performance, both on and off the pitch.
